电弧喷铝防腐涂层组织与性能的研究

摘    要:用SEM、SRD等分析技术,研究了电弧喷Al涂层、Zn涂层及Al-Zn伪合金涂层的显微组织和相组成,测试了三种涂层的力学性能和有机酸中性盐介质中的耐腐蚀性能。结果表明,Al涂层的结合性能和耐腐蚀性能均优于Zn涂层和Al-Zn伪合金涂层。

Microstructure and Property of Arc Spraying Aluminum Coating for Corrosion Prevention

Abstract:The microstructure and phase composition of arc spraying Al coating, Zn coating and Al-Zn pseudo-alloy coating were investigated by using SEM, XRD and other analysis technology. The mechanical proper- ties or the three kinds or coatings and their anti-corrosion properties in organic acid environment and salt me- dium were also measured. The results indicate that the adhesive strength and corrosion-resistant property of Al coating are superior to those of Zn coating and Al-Zn pseudo-alloy coating.
